Major operators in Hungary end Q1 2011 with 1.48 million digital TV subscribers
(Márciusban közel 1,48 millió digitálistelevízió-előfizetés volt hazánkban)
Wednesday, May 18th, 2011
In March 2011, the number of households with digital television subscriptions in the network of Hungary’s twelve largest broadcasters rose to 1,479,520, states a flash report released by the country’s National Media and Infocommunications Authority (Nemzeti Média- és Hírközlési Hatóság – NMHH). Satellite subscribers accounted for 890,545 of the digital total with cable and IPTV making up the remaining 588,975.
The flash report is based on data provided on a voluntary basis by Hungary’s 12 largest broadcasters and covers approximately 80 to 85 percent of the subscription television services market. The service providers featured – Magyar Telekom Nyrt., Invitel Zrt., UPC Magyarország Kft., FiberNet Zrt., DIGI Kft., PR-TELEKOM Zrt., Tarr Kft., ViDaNet Zrt., PARISAT Kft., RubiCom Zrt., Hello HD Kft. and UPC DTH S.à.r.l. – registered a total of 2,695,785 subscriptions at the end of March.
Television subscriptions, based on data from the major service providers (1000s):
2010
-----------------------------------------------------------
Mar Apr May June July Aug Sept Oct Nov Dec
----- ----- ----- ----- ----- ----- ----- ----- ----- -----
Total 2,509 2,517 2,527 2,527 2,524 2,539 2,550 2,587 2,618 2,666
Digital 1,210 1,225 1,240 1,258 1,279 1,299 1,322 1,354 1,385 1,423
2011
-----------------
Jan Feb Mar
----- ----- -----
Total 2,681 2,692 2,696
Digital 1,450 1,465 1,480
